首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

dedecms dedecms

DedeCMS基础概念

DedeCMS(织梦内容管理系统)是一款基于PHP+MySQL技术的开源网站内容管理系统。它以简单、实用和开源免费的特点,在国内中小型网站建站领域得到了广泛应用。DedeCMS提供了丰富的功能,包括文章管理、会员管理、模板管理等,使得用户能够轻松搭建和管理自己的网站。

DedeCMS的优势

  1. 开源免费:DedeCMS是一款开源软件,用户可以自由获取源代码,并根据自己的需求进行二次开发。
  2. 功能丰富:提供了文章管理、会员管理、模板管理等多种功能,满足了不同类型网站的需求。
  3. 操作简单:DedeCMS的用户界面友好,操作简单易懂,即使是初学者也能快速上手。
  4. 安全性高:DedeCMS在安全方面做了很多优化,如数据库备份、文件权限设置等,确保网站的安全稳定运行。

DedeCMS的类型

DedeCMS主要分为两种类型:完整版和精简版。完整版包含了DedeCMS的所有功能,适用于对网站功能要求较高的用户;而精简版则去除了部分不常用的功能,适用于对网站性能要求较高的用户。

DedeCMS的应用场景

DedeCMS适用于各类中小型网站的搭建和管理,如新闻网站、企业网站、个人博客等。通过DedeCMS,用户可以轻松实现网站的搭建、内容更新和维护等工作。

常见问题及解决方法

  1. DedeCMS后台登录失败
    • 原因:可能是数据库连接信息错误、后台登录地址被修改或服务器环境问题等。
    • 解决方法:检查数据库连接信息是否正确,确认后台登录地址是否被恶意修改,检查服务器环境是否满足DedeCMS的运行要求。
  • DedeCMS文章无法发布
    • 原因:可能是权限设置问题、数据库问题或模板问题等。
    • 解决方法:检查会员权限设置,确保会员具有发布文章的权限;检查数据库是否正常,如有损坏可尝试修复;检查模板文件是否正确安装和配置。
  • DedeCMS网站访问速度慢
    • 原因:可能是服务器性能问题、网站代码优化不足或数据库查询效率低等。
    • 解决方法:升级服务器配置以提高性能;对网站代码进行优化,减少不必要的计算和请求;优化数据库查询语句,提高查询效率。

示例代码

以下是一个简单的DedeCMS文章发布示例代码:

代码语言:txt
复制
<?php
// 引入DedeCMS核心文件
require_once(dirname(__FILE__).'/include/common.inc.php');

// 创建文章对象
$article = new Dede_Article();

// 设置文章基本属性
$article->Title = '示例文章标题';
$article->Keywords = '示例,文章,关键词';
$article->Description = '这是一篇示例文章的描述';
$article->Content = '这是示例文章的内容';

// 设置文章其他属性
$article->TypeId = 1; // 分类ID
$article->Arcrank = 0; // 文章权重
$article->IsMake = 1; // 是否生成静态页面
$article->IsCommend = 0; // 是否推荐

// 发布文章
if($article->Save()) {
    echo '文章发布成功!';
} else {
    echo '文章发布失败!';
}
?>

参考链接

DedeCMS官方文档:https://www.dedecms.com/help/

请注意,以上信息仅供参考,如有需要,建议咨询专业技术人员。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券